Rakefile in katapult-0.4.1 vs Rakefile in katapult-0.5.0
- old
+ new
@@ -14,14 +14,14 @@
RSpec::Core::RakeTask.new(:spec)
task :update_readme do
require_relative 'lib/katapult/version'
readme_path = 'README.md'
+
readme = File.read readme_path
+ readme.sub! /\A# Katapult.*\nGenerating.*\n/, '# ' + `bin/katapult version`
+ readme.sub! /(required .Ruby. version is )[\d\.]+\d/, "\\1#{Katapult::RUBY_VERSION}"
- # Using \s+ to support line breaks
- readme.sub! /(currently\s+it's\s+Rails\s+)[\d\.]+/, "\\1#{Katapult::RAILS_VERSION}"
- readme.sub! /(and\s+Ruby\s+)[\d\.]+\d/, "\\1#{Katapult::RUBY_VERSION}"
File.open readme_path, 'w' do |f|
f.write readme
end
end